4. Actions for Installing a Sliding Screen Door
Action 1: Measure the Door Frame
Utilizing a determining tape, measure the height and width of the door frame where the sliding screen door will be set up. Be sure to measure in multiple places to ensure accuracy. Utilize the tiniest measurements for the best fit.
Step 2: Purchase the Right Door
Based upon your measurements, purchase a sliding screen door that fits your measurements. Many home improvement stores bring a wide range of styles and sizes.

Action 3: Prepare the Door Frame
Before installation, clean the edges of the door frame to guarantee no particles or old paint disrupts the door's fit. Utilize an utility knife to clear away any obstacles.
Step 4: Install the Track
- Dry Fit the Track: Place the track into the door frame to inspect the fit.
- Mark the Drill Holes: With the track in position, use a pencil to mark where you require to drill holes for the screws.
- Drill the Holes: Using a drill and the proper bit size, drill holes into the frame at the significant points.
- Attach the Track: Align the track to the drilled holes and use screws to protect it in location.
Step 5: Install the Rollers
Most sliding screen doors come with pre-installed rollers. If yours does not, follow these actions:
- Attach Rollers to the Bottom of the Door: Secure them according to the maker's directions.
- Change the Rollers: Some might need getting used to fit your track properly.
Step 6: Hang the Screen Door
- Raise the Door into Place: Align the rollers with the track and thoroughly lift the door to set it on the track.
- Look for Smoothness: Slide the door backward and forward to guarantee it moves effortlessly.
Action 7: Secure the Door
Depending on your design, you may need to secure the top part of the door into place. Follow the maker's instructions to do so.
Step 8: Final Adjustments
- Level the Door: Use a level to ensure the door is straight.
- Adjust the Rollers Again: Make any necessary adjustments to the rollers for optimum motion.
5. Maintenance Tips for Sliding Screen Doors
To ensure longevity and performance, carry out routine maintenance on your sliding screen door:
- Clean the Tracks: Dust and particles can build up, making it challenging to slide the door open and shut. Use a vacuum or damp cloth to clean up the track.
- Check for Damage: Frequently examine the screen for tears or rips, and the rollers for wear.
- Oil the Track: Use silicone spray or dry lube on the track to preserve smooth operation.
